express-errors
Express middleware for displaying Rails-inspired error pages for development environments with error name, message, stack trace and extracted code around source of error.
Note: It does not swallow errors, they still get the same usual output in the console.

Installation
$ npm install express-errs --save
Question: Why is the name so weird? Because express is so popular, it was impossible to find a normal name for this package.
Usage
var express = require('express');
var errors = require('express-errs');
var app = express();
app.get('/', function (req, res) {
throw new Error('Oh no!');
res.end('Oh yes!');
});
app.use(errors());
app.listen(3000);
